ARTstor

  • Start by going to Artstor.
  • In the upper right corner, click Log in (or Register if you've not yet done so). Registering for an account will allow you to download images to use in your assignments and presentations.
  • Next click on Advanced Search under the Search Artstor box.
  • Enter your search terms in the boxes under Search for words or phrases. (You can also limit your search to the Title or Creator field by using the drop-down menu, or you can keep the default setting and search in any field.) 
  • (Optional) you may also want to specify a date range, geographic location, or classification (medium) by using the DateGeography, or Classification filters. (NOTE: the more filters you use, the fewer results you will get.)
  • Once you've found an image of interest, click on it to enlarge it.
  • Click DOWNLOAD to download the image. 

Citing images

Images must be cited like all other resources! If you use an image you did not create, you must provide a citation. The citation should be accessible in the context of the image's use (within a PowerPoint presentation, on a Web page, in a paper, etc.).

To cite ARTstor images, click on the information (i) icon below the image to find the artist's name, title of artwork, date of creation, and repository.

In this class you are to use Chicago style citations. In Chicago style, images can be cited using captions or using footnotes/endnotes with a corresponding bibliography entry. Check with your instructor for her preference.

Bibliographic entry

Gogh, Vincent van. The Starry Night. 1889. Oil on canvas.  29 in. x 36 ¼ in. Museum of Modern Art, New York. ARTstor. Accessed April 7, 2016.http://library.artstor.org.tacomacc.idm.oclc.org/library/iv2.html?parent=true#.

Footnote/endnote

18Vincent van Gogh, The Starry Night, 1889, oil on canvas, 29 in. x 36 ¼ in., Museum of Modern Art, New York, ARTstor, accessed April 7, 2016,http://library.artstor.org.tacomacc.idm.oclc.org/library/iv2.html?parent=true#.

Caption

NOTE: Captions can be done as figure, fig., illustration, or ill.

Fig. 1: Vincent Van Gogh, The Starry Night, 1889, oil on canvas, 29 in. x 36 ¼ in., Museum of Modern Art, New York, ARTstor, accessed April 7, 2016, http://library.artstor.org.tacomacc.idm.oclc.org/library/iv2.html?parent=true#.
